Heroes Unmasked - Season 3

Season 3
Episodes

Pandora's Box
An exclusive peek behind the scenes of the award-winning series. Meet a brand-new character whose arrival is sure to be a hit as the Heroes face a cataclysmic future.

New Heroes on the Block
An exclusive peek behind the scenes of Heroes. We discover how Level 5 was created, and the writers discuss how they mastermind their infamous cliffhangers.

On a Heroic Scale
An exclusive peek behind the scenes of Heroes. The show's creators reveal the challenges of packing a feature film into 45 minutes of television every week.

Playing God
An exclusive peek behind the scenes of Heroes. We talk exclusively to Malcolm McDowell and creator Tim King, and examine the themes of religion and spirituality.

Shock of the Old
An exclusive peek behind the scenes of Heroes. Delving into the workings of the characters who return from the dead, and the way in which they are introduced.

Teenage Kicks
An exclusive peek behind the scenes of Heroes. A further look into the trials and tribulations of troubled teen, Claire.

A Bug's Life
An exclusive peek behind the scenes of Heroes. A look at how Pinehearst, Arthur Petrelli's sinister inner sanctum, was designed.

Missing Links
This episode of the series reveals the extent Arthur Petrelli is prepared to go to in his pursuit of power, where not even his family can stand in the way.

Action!
Heroes Unmasked comes straight from the director's chair this week, as the men and women at the helm of Heroes reveal what it takes to call the shots.

Let's Get Physical
From striking visual effects to shocking prosthetics and demanding fights, the outstanding physical skill behind Heroes is on display, including the Elephant Man.

Heroes By Design
Heroes Unmasked steps back in time to look at how Production Designer Ruth Ammon and her team planned out their Haiti designs from the very beginning.

The Music of Heroes
Join composers Wendy Melvoin and Lisa Coleman at their studios in Los Angeles to hear how they created the Heroes soundtrack.

Heroes on the Run
As Volume Three signs off in dramatic style, Heroes Unmasked ends with an equally thrilling climax, showing the heroes in their greatest danger yet.

Beyond the Gates
Beyond the Gates is set in a leafy Maryland suburb just outside of Washington D.C., and in one the most affluent African American counties in the United States. Here you'll find a posh gated community with winding tree-lined streets and luxurious mansions to call home. At the center of this community are the Duprees, a powerful and prestigious multi-generational family that is the very definition of Black royalty. But behind these pristine walls and lush, manicured gardens are juicy secrets and scandals waiting to be uncovered. And those that live outside these gates are watching closely. These are the places where our characters live, love, work and play. Those who have "made it" and those who haven't are all trying to navigate life … and some with more grace than others.

Doc
Doc centers on the hard-charging, brilliant Dr. Amy Larsen, Chief of Internal and Family Medicine at Westside Hospital in Minneapolis. After a brain injury erases the last eight years of her life, Amy must navigate an unfamiliar world where she has no recollection of patients she's treated, colleagues she's crossed, the soulmate she divorced, the man she now loves and the tragedy that caused her to push everyone away. She can rely only on her estranged 17-year-old daughter, whom she remembers as a 9-year-old, and a handful of devoted friends, as she struggles to continue practicing medicine, despite having lost nearly a decade of knowledge and experience.
